Summary: | PROBLEM TO BE SOLVED: To provide a purification method of a contaminated ground capable of accelerating evaporation of a contaminant by setting a temperature of a steam to be injected to the ground at relatively high temperature and capable of purifying the contaminant, which has been evaporated with the high-temperature steam, effectively with ozone.SOLUTION: The method involves a steam injection step where a high-temperature steam is supplied to a drilling pipe 3 inserted in a ground, followed by injecting the steam to the ground via a perforation provided in the drilling pipe 3. The method also involves an ozone-containing gas injection step where an ozone-containing gas containing ozone as a composition gas is supplied to a plurality of drilling pipes 5 inserted in the ground at a position apart from the drilling pipe 3 and also surrounding the drilling pipe 3, followed by injecting the ozone-containing gas to the ground via perforations provided in the drilling pipes 5. The ozone-containing gas injection step is performed while performing the steam injection step.SELECTED DRAWING: Figure 2
